What This Corner of Birch Bay Does to a Deck
Salt Air Off the Bay
Even set back from the water, homes in the Terrell Creek area still get a steady dose of salt-carrying air moving inland off Birch Bay. It's usually a lighter dose than a property sitting directly on the shoreline, but it's not nothing — salt accelerates corrosion in exposed fasteners, brackets, and railing hardware, and a fastener that starts corroding loses holding strength well before it looks obviously bad. On a structure people walk and stand on, that matters regardless of how far the lot sits from the water.
Driving Rain and Wind
Storms moving through this part of Whatcom County don't just drop rain straight down; wind pushes it sideways, up under railings, into ledger connections, and between deck boards that aren't gapped the way they should be. A deck surface designed for calm, dry conditions can shed water fine on a still afternoon and still trap moisture the moment wind gets involved — which, in this area, is most of the wet season.
A Moss Season That Runs Most of the Year
Mild temperatures and near-constant moisture give moss and mildew a long growing season across Birch Bay, and horizontal decking surfaces are usually among the first places it takes hold, since they hold water longer than a vertical wall and stay damp between rain events. Properties near Terrell Creek often carry more tree cover than open shoreline lots, and shade plus moisture is exactly the combination moss needs — a shaded deck here can start showing growth well before a sun-exposed one a few blocks away does.
Tree Cover, Grade, and Site Drainage
Being near a creek corridor generally means more mature trees, more organic debris falling onto a deck surface through the year, and, on some lots, grade that slopes toward the drainage rather than away from the house. None of that is a problem on its own, but it changes what a correctly built deck needs to account for — better gapping to shed leaf litter and needles, and framing and footing placement that respects how water actually moves across the specific lot rather than assuming it drains the way a flat, open yard would.
Choosing the Right Decking Material for This Climate
Material choice matters more here than it would on a drier, more sheltered site, because the gap in performance between a well-suited product and a poorly-suited one shows up faster under sustained moisture and shade. The three main categories homeowners weigh are pressure-treated or cedar wood, capped composite, and cellular PVC.
Wood
Pressure-treated lumber and cedar are the traditional choice and look great when new, but both need regular sealing or staining to hold up against sustained moisture, and both are more vulnerable to fastener corrosion issues in salt-influenced air over time. On a shaded lot near Terrell Creek, unmaintained wood is usually the first material to show moss, graying, and soft spots — often within a season or two.
Capped Composite
Capped composite boards have a plastic shell around a wood-fiber composite core, which resists moisture absorption, staining, and UV fade far better than uncapped composite or bare wood. In a shaded, moisture-heavy setting like much of this area, that cap layer is doing real work — it's the difference between a board that needs occasional washing and one that needs ongoing sealing to keep moss from taking hold.
Cellular PVC
PVC decking contains no wood fiber at all, so it doesn't absorb moisture the way even capped composite can at cut edges or fastener holes. It typically costs more than composite and can flex more under heavy point loads, but for a heavily shaded deck near tree cover and moisture, some homeowners find the added moisture resistance worth the extra cost.
| Material | Handling Salt Air & Moisture | Moss Resistance in Shade | Upkeep |
|---|---|---|---|
| Cellular PVC | Excellent — no wood fiber to absorb moisture | Strong, smooth non-porous surface | Occasional washing |
| Capped composite | Strong — cap layer resists moisture and staining | Good on most product lines | Occasional washing |
| Uncapped composite | Moderate — some moisture absorption at exposed fiber | Fair; more prone to buildup under tree cover | Periodic cleaning |
| Cedar | Moderate — natural resistance, but needs sealing | Fair when sealed and maintained | Regular oiling or sealing |
| Pressure-treated wood | Weak against sustained salt exposure over time | Poor without regular treatment | Regular sealing or staining |
What a Correctly Built Deck Involves Here
The decking surface gets most of the attention when homeowners picture a custom deck, but in this climate, the framing, fasteners, and drainage details underneath are what actually determine how long it lasts. A build done right for the Terrell Creek area includes:
- Framing material suited to sustained moisture exposure — pressure-treated lumber rated for the application, sized correctly for the span and load
- Corrosion-resistant fasteners throughout, not standard hardware that starts corroding in salt-influenced air within a few seasons
- Hidden fastener systems on the deck surface where the product allows, reducing exposed metal and giving a cleaner walking surface
- Correct board gapping for drainage and material movement, wide enough to shed leaf litter and needles from nearby tree cover as well as water
- Proper ledger board flashing where the deck ties into the house, since that connection point is one of the most common places moisture gets in on a poorly built deck
- Footing and framing layout that accounts for the lot's actual grade and drainage pattern rather than a generic layout dropped onto the site
- Joist spacing matched to the specific decking product's span rating
- Ventilation and grading underneath the deck so moisture and organic debris don't sit against the framing between storms
Skip any one of those and the deck usually still looks fine on day one. The problems show up a few winters later, as a soft joist, a loosening railing post, or moss working into fastener heads and staining the boards around them.
Site Considerations Specific to This Area
Properties near Terrell Creek sometimes sit close enough to the creek corridor or its associated drainage that county critical-area or shoreline setback rules can come into play, depending on the specific lot. That's not true of every property in the neighborhood, but it's worth checking before finalizing a deck's footprint rather than after footings are poured. We check lot-specific setback and permitting requirements as part of the design process, so a homeowner isn't the one left untangling that with the county mid-project.
Tree cover near the creek also affects design decisions that don't come up the same way on an open shoreline lot: how much of the deck sits in shade through the day, whether overhanging branches will need trimming to keep moisture and debris off the surface, and how footing placement works around root systems on wooded lots. A custom deck design has to work with those site realities, not just a stock layout dropped onto the property.

What Your Deck Still Needs From You
Even a well-built deck in the right material needs some routine attention in this climate to reach its full lifespan. A short list worth keeping in mind:
- Clear leaves, needles, and organic debris from board gaps regularly, since tree cover near the creek adds more of it than an open lot sees
- Rinse or wash the deck surface periodically to clear salt residue and organic buildup before it works into the surface or cap layer
- Check railing posts and hardware once a year for early corrosion or loosening, especially heading into the wet season
- Trim back overhanging branches that hold moisture against the deck or block sun and airflow across the surface
- Address any soft framing or standing water underneath right away — that's a structural issue, not a cosmetic one, and it doesn't improve with time
